Flat glass prices finally level out

September 16, 2016/in Blog, Glass Paint/by eileen

According to the Bureau of Labor Statistics’ Producer Price Index (PPI), the price of flat glass leveled out in July, for the first time in five months. Prices increased just .1% in July and .2% in August, following months of full percentage increases. Overall, the price of flat glass has increased 8% since last year, […]

Mercury glass makes a comeback

September 15, 2016/in Blog, Glass Paint/by eileen

If you’ve never heard of mercury glass (also called silvered glass), it just means that you weren’t born in the 19th century! Genuine mercury glass is a decorative, double-walled, hand-blown glass that has a layer of mercury or silver sandwiched between the layers. The term “mercury” is a bit misleading; elemental mercury is not used […]

New glass could improve solar cell efficiency

September 13, 2016/in Blog, Glass Paint/by eileen

Researchers at ITMO University in St. Petersburg, Russia have developed a new glass that emits visible light when in the presence of ultraviolet radiation. UV radiation normally counteracts the performance of solar cells, and diminishes the practical lifetime of the cell. Glass can convert UV radiation to visible light This glass could intercept UV radiation […]

Stained glass future in doubt

September 12, 2016/in Blog, Glass Paint/by eileen

Churches around the United States are finding themselves in a new battle – one that pits their cherished stained glass artwork against the environment. Stained glass suppliers and manufacturers are being limited by federal regulations governing lead and other heavy metal emissions from glass furnaces. That makes the future of stained glass uncertain. It also […]
